Really tight on funds, put an Enfield on layaway, may do the
same for this one. 1939 date 7.35 Carcano, Finn marked. No bayo,
good bore. Rough SA marked sling. Pretty decent shape, $179 OTD.
I know about the ammo availability issues, but as a collectible
it would fit nicely with my Finn mosins. I know if I ask,
everyone will say "buy it", but looking input anyway. ;D
Finn marked Carcanos are VERY common here but usually bubba
molested, if you see a Carcano carbine chances are it's SA
marked. This is the first I've seen with sling though. I didn't
even have a chance to look for matching numbers.
